Description

Nestled within a central location, we are delighted to present this charming 2-bedroom bungalow to the market, offered with NO CHAIN. This freehold property boasts a traditional layout with a generous reception room, two bedrooms, and a bathroom. The accommodation further benefits from a detached garden storage unit, providing ample space for storage needs. Stepping outside, you are greeted by an established garden featuring flower beds and a well-maintained lawn, offering a peaceful retreat. The property is placed in Tax Band B, ensuring a reasonable council tax bill. The EPC for this property is yet to be confirmed, offering an exciting opportunity for the new owners to enhance the energy efficiency of this lovely bungalow.

The outside space of this property includes a manageable garden area accessed via a well-kept garden path leading to the front door and extending to the rear garden. The rear garden presents a tranquil setting with a tarred patio area bordered by lush green hedges, perfect for enjoying al fresco dining or relaxing in the sunshine. A substantial garden storage room also stands tall, featuring side and front aspect windows and a timber door providing convenient additional space.
